Entitle for Teams | Entitle

Overview

Microsoft Teams is a proprietary business communication platform developed by Microsoft as part of the Microsoft 365 family of products. Teams offer workspace chat and video conferencing, file storage, and application integration.

Entitle can be added as an app on Microsoft Teams. This will require an admin to configure the integration between Entitle and Teams through the Entitle web app. Then, the admin needs to add the Entitle app to the list of available apps in your organization to allow end users to install it to Teams.

🚧

Important information

The Microsoft Teams integration requires a one-to-one match between a user's email address in Entitle and their email address in Microsoft Teams.

If these email addresses do not match, users may see an Unauthorized error when selecting New Request in the Entitle Teams app.

To resolve this issue, make sure that the user's email address is identical and properly synchronized in both Entitle and Microsoft Teams.

Integrate Teams with Entitle

ℹ️

Only Entitle admins can configure the integration with Teams.

  1. Log in to Entitle and navigate to the Org settings page.

  2. In the Integrations section, click Add and choose Teams from the list.

    Screenshot of adding teams integration
  3. Grant your consent in the Azure portal.

    ℹ️

    • User.Read, profile, email: Access the current user's basic information, such as name and email.
    • Access as a user: Entitle's application includes a secured iFrame. To sign in users securely, Entitle accesses Microsoft APIs on the user's behalf after consent is granted.
    • offline_access: Allows access to user data when the user it not actively using the Entitle application.

    Entitle can access only the data permitted by these scopes and cannot access content outside the application's scope, such as messages sent outside of Entitle.

The Teams app is now integrated with Entitle.

Upload the Entitle app to your org’s app catalog

ℹ️

  1. This step can only be performed by an Entitle admin. However, in some cases, users may be able to upload the app themselves, depending on the implemented Teams policy.
  2. This step is required to enable end-users to install the Entitle app from their app catalog in Teams.
  3. If you are setting up an Entitle on-premise deployment, contact Entitle's representatives to obtain a custom app manifest for your tenant.
  1. Download Entitle's app manifest:
    1. App manifest for Entitle EU region
    2. App manifest for Entitle US region
    3. App manifest for the Entitle CA region
ℹ️

You can determine which region you're using based on the URL:

  1. In the left-side navigation bar in Teams, click Apps.

  2. On the Apps screen, select Manage your apps.

  3. Select Upload an app.

    Screenshot of uploading a new app on teams
  4. Select the Upload an app to your org’s app catalog option, and upload the manifest you previously downloaded.

    Screenshot of upload an app screen

    The Entitle app will appear on your organization’s apps catalog on the Apps screen.

Install the Entitle app to Teams

ℹ️

This step is mandatory to receive notifications through the Entitle app in Teams.

  1. In the left-side navigation bar in Teams, click Apps.
  2. You should see the Entitle app in your org’s app catalog. Click Add > Add.
screenshot of entitle app in catalog

In case the Entitle app does not appear in the org's app catalog:

  1. Make sure the user who uploads the app is an org admin.
  2. Search for the Entitle app in this portal and upload it again. This step allows you to control which users are exposed to the app and able to install it. Review the list of users before proceeding.
  3. Once the user(s) logs in to Teams again, the Entitle app should appear in the Apps screen.
ℹ️

To guidance on how to perform the following actions with the Entitle app on Teams:

  • Receive notifications and updates
  • View files that were shared with you
  • Create a new permission request
  • View and manage your Entitle user profile

See the Entitle for Teams end-user guide.


©2003-2026 BeyondTrust Corporation. All Rights Reserved. Other trademarks identified on this page are owned by their respective owners. BeyondTrust is not a chartered bank or trust company, or depository institution. It is not authorized to accept deposits or trust accounts and is not licensed or regulated by any state or federal banking authority.